Title of article :
Ultrasound-assisted coating of silk yarn with sphere-like Mn3O4 nanoparticles

Abstract :
The growth of sphere-like trimanganese tetraoxide (Mn3O4) nanoparticles on silk fiber was achieved by sequential dipping in an alternating bath of potassium hydroxide and manganese(II) nitrate under ultrasound irradiation. Some parameters such as the effect of pH, numerous sequential dipping and ultrasonic irradiation on growth of the nanoparticles have been studied. The samples were characterized with powder X-ray diffraction (XRD), scanning electron microscopy (SEM) and wavelength dispersive X-ray (WDX).
